Grammar usage guide and real-world examplesUSAGE SUMMARY
The phrase "pending agreement" is correct and usable in written English.
It is typically used to indicate that something is awaiting approval or confirmation before it can proceed. Example: "The contract will be finalized pending agreement from both parties involved."

Expert writing Tips
Best practice
When using "pending agreement", ensure that the context clearly indicates what the agreement pertains to and what conditions need to be met for it to be finalized.
Common error
Avoid using "pending agreement" without specifying the parties involved or the subject matter of the agreement. Providing clarity prevents confusion and ensures the reader understands the situation.

More alternative expressions(10)
Phrases that express similar concepts, ordered by semantic similarity:
awaiting agreement
Emphasizes the state of waiting for the agreement to be formally approved.
subject to agreement
Highlights that the finalization is conditional upon reaching an agreement.
agreement in progress
Focuses on the ongoing nature of the agreement's development.
agreement under negotiation
Specifies that the agreement is currently being discussed and refined.
unratified agreement
Indicates the agreement has not yet received formal ratification or approval.
proposed agreement
Highlights that the agreement is still in the proposal stage.
tentative agreement
Suggests the agreement is provisional and may be subject to change.
inchoate agreement
Implies the agreement is just beginning to take form.
prospective agreement
Highlights the potential for a future agreement.
preliminary agreement
Emphasizes that the agreement is in its initial stages.
FAQs
How to use "pending agreement" in a sentence?
You can use "pending agreement" to describe a situation where a formal agreement is expected but not yet finalized. For example, "The deal is set to go through, "pending agreement" from the board of directors."
What can I say instead of "pending agreement"?
You can use alternatives like "awaiting agreement", "subject to agreement", or "agreement in progress" depending on the specific nuance you want to convey.
Is "pending agreement" formal or informal?
"Pending agreement" is generally considered neutral to formal in tone, suitable for business, news, and academic contexts. It's less common in very casual conversation.
What is the difference between "pending agreement" and "existing agreement"?
"Pending agreement" refers to an agreement that is not yet finalized, while "existing agreement" indicates that an agreement is already in place and active.
